The Pop Princesses and Chart-Topping Queens
First up, let's talk about the pop queens who have ruled the charts and our hearts. Names like Madonna immediately come to mind. She's not just a singer; she's an icon, a cultural force, and a boundary-pusher. Madonna redefined what it meant to be a pop star, constantly reinventing herself and captivating audiences with her music, her style, and her fearless attitude. Her impact on music videos and stage performances is undeniable, influencing countless artists who followed. Then there's Britney Spears, the princess who became a global phenomenon. She captured the hearts of millions with her catchy tunes and iconic dance moves. Her influence on the pop music landscape and the rise of the teen pop genre can't be overstated. And, of course, Beyoncé, the queen of everything! With her incredible vocals, mesmerizing performances, and dedication to her craft, Beyoncé has cemented her place as one of the most significant artists of our time. From her Destiny's Child days to her solo career, she's consistently delivered hits, pushing creative boundaries and advocating for social change. Soulful Voices and R&B Divas
Now, let's turn our attention to the soulful voices and R&B divas who have given us some of the most emotionally charged and captivating music ever. We can't talk about R&B without mentioning Whitney Houston, a powerhouse vocalist with an unparalleled range and control. Her voice was simply a gift, and her songs, filled with passion and vulnerability, resonated with listeners worldwide. Then there's Aretha Franklin, the Queen of Soul. Her gospel-infused vocals, her raw emotion, and her unwavering dedication to her craft made her a legend. Her music continues to inspire, and her legacy as a cultural icon remains unmatched. And let's not forget Mariah Carey, known for her incredible vocal range, including her famous whistle register. She revolutionized the sound of R&B and pop with her five-octave range and her ability to hit those super high notes. Country Music Trailblazers
Let's head on down to Nashville and celebrate the country music trailblazers who have told their stories through heartfelt songs and captivating melodies. Dolly Parton, an icon in every sense of the word, is one of the most recognizable and beloved figures in country music. Her songwriting, her charismatic personality, and her philanthropy have made her a national treasure. Then there’s Shania Twain, who brought a pop sensibility to country music, crossing over into mainstream success with her catchy tunes and empowering anthems. Her ability to blend genres and appeal to a broader audience helped shape the landscape of country music. And let's not forget Taylor Swift, who started her career in country music and has since become a global superstar. Her songwriting prowess and her ability to connect with her fans have made her one of the most successful artists of her generation. Rock Icons and Songwriting Legends
Let's rock out with the rock icons and songwriting legends who have shaped the sound of rock music. Names like Janis Joplin come to mind. Her raw, blues-infused vocals and her powerful stage presence made her a rock 'n' roll legend. She wasn't afraid to be vulnerable, and her music continues to inspire generations of artists. Then there's Stevie Nicks, the mystical voice of Fleetwood Mac. Her songwriting, her distinctive style, and her ethereal stage presence have made her a rock icon. Her contributions to the band's iconic albums have cemented her place in music history. And let's not forget Joan Jett, the queen of rock 'n' roll rebellion. Her music, filled with raw energy and unapologetic attitude, has empowered countless fans.
